Transaction 31f054aec13deab92559f160d0eb5f928250fa616e41ff079760e888fb361d96
1 Input
1 Output
-
31f054aec13deab92559f160d0eb5f928250fa616e41ff079760e888fb361d96:0
- value
- 77490
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ff58d8271717f6f2700b1990969df010f15950b3 OP_EQUAL
- address
- 3QyAfUSXrhNfFVjjmSbQhnXZPtq5Ti5SSc